| @Transform を使って JSON を作成し XAgent で出力として利用する方法 |
|
katoman |
Aug 19, 2015 |
| compositeData から OneUI のプレースバーにボタンを追加する方法 |
アプリケーションレイアウトコントロールのあるカスタムコントールの afterPageLoad イベントに配置。AbstractTreeNode タイプのコントロールにカスタムプロパティを追加し、複数イ |
katoman |
Aug 19, 2015 |
| DbLookup と DbColumn、キャッシュ付き、ソート付き、ユニークな値のみ |
指定するパラメーターの内容はコード内のコメントに記述 |
katoman |
Aug 19, 2015 |
| dojo DataGrid から選択された行のUNIDを取得 |
dojo DataGrid から選択された行のUNIDを取得するCSJSを含んだXPAGESのサンプルです |
kazut |
Aug 28, 2016 |
| Dominoオブジェクトを利用する場合のリサイクル処理 |
|
guylocke |
Jul 17, 2018 |
| getComponentValue |
コンポーネントの値を取得するときに、getValue() や getSubmittedValue() を使うと思いますが、この関数はその際の問題をなくします。 |
katoman |
Aug 19, 2015 |
| inputRichText コントロール (CKEditor) にコンテンツを追加するには |
このスニペッツには inputRichText コントロールにリッチテキストコンテンツを追加するものです。
トリックは com.ibm.xsp.http.MimeMultipart を使うことです。 |
katoman |
Aug 19, 2015 |
| JavaScriptのオブジェクトを構造解析 |
JavaScriptのオブジェクトを渡すと解析して文字列にしてくれる。printすればログに表示可能。
改行コードも表示できるように修正 |
yac4423 |
Dec 1, 2015 |
| MIME を使って SSJS で HTML メールを作成 |
使用方法についてはこのクラスの上部にある記述を参照するか私のブログをご覧ください:
http://linqed.eu/?p=45
|
katoman |
Aug 18, 2015 |
| Rich Text Field(CKEditor) ツールバーのカスタマイズ |
Rich Text Field(CKEditor) ツールバーのカスタマイズを自由に行いたいときのサンプルコードです。 |
kazut |
Aug 28, 2016 |
| SSJS で SessionID を取得 |
|
katoman |
Aug 19, 2015 |
| SSJS でカレンダーエントリの作成 |
メールファイルに予定を作成します。 |
katoman |
Aug 19, 2015 |
| SSJS でビューデータソースを追加する |
XPage に動的にデータソースを追加します。
1. afterPageLoad にこの関数を追加します: addViewDataSource("server!!database.nsf","view |
katoman |
Aug 19, 2015 |
| @Transform で JSON を構成し、XAgent 内で出力できるようにする |
|
katoman |
Jul 21, 2015 |
| URL のリダイレクト |
|
katoman |
Aug 19, 2015 |
| URL パラメーターの取得 |
|
katoman |
Aug 19, 2015 |
| viewPanelの行数(rows)のデフォルト30行をプログラムにて変更 |
|
kazut |
Jul 17, 2018 |
| XPage で新規文書を作成する際の読者名フィールドの設定 |
a) データバインディングのソースのプロパティ「computeWithForm」に「onsave」を指定。onsave は文書保存時にフォームの計算を行い、読者名の属性を新規文書にも引き継ぐ動きをしま |
katoman |
Aug 19, 2015 |
| コンポーネントの選択可能な値を取得する |
SSJS 経由であるコンポーネントの選択可能な値すべてにアクセスする方法 |
katoman |
Aug 19, 2015 |
| コンボボックスの値を@DBColumnで指定したら32KBオーバーでエラーになった場合の回避 |
|
kazzwach |
Jul 17, 2018 |
| サーバーサイド妥当性検査が失敗したらクライアントサイドのアラートを表示する方法 |
8.5.3 以降で有効。 |
katoman |
Aug 19, 2015 |
| スコープ変数に格納されている全ての値をクリアー |
スコープ変数に格納されている全ての値をクリアーするSSJSの関数です。 引数にsessionScopeなどスコープ変数を指定します。 |
kazut |
Aug 28, 2016 |
| チェックボックスの値をクリアする |
|
guylocke |
Nov 14, 2018 |
| データコンテナのパフォーマンスの問題に対する対処法 |
このコードはデータコンテナ(繰り返しコントロール、データ表など)が必要のないときに再計算されることを防ぐもの、コードはこのデータコンテナの <xp:this.value></xp:this.value |
katoman |
Jul 13, 2015 |
| ビデオコントロール(カスタムコントロール) |
compositeData.autoplay autoplay :Specifies that the video will start playing as soon as it is read |
mak |
Jun 15, 2018 |
| ビューのカテゴリをすべて省略する |
viewPanel のカテゴリをすべて省略するボタンの JavaScript (Server) です。 |
tyoshida |
Dec 4, 2015 |
| ビューのカテゴリをすべて展開する |
viewPanel のカテゴリをすべて展開するボタンの JavaScript (Server) です。 |
tyoshida |
Dec 4, 2015 |
| ビューパネルで選択した文書の値を取得する |
ビューパネル(ViewPanel1)で選択した文書の値(MailAddressフィールド)を取得して、SendToフィールドに設定しています。
また、「サーバーオプション」にて、SendToフィールド |
tyoshida |
Mar 15, 2017 |
| ファイルダウンロードコントロールで表示数を無制限に動的設定 |
|
kazut |
Jul 17, 2018 |
| ページが1ページだけのときにページャを表示させない方法 |
表示ページが1ページしかないビューのときにページャのプロパティでこのを非表示にする関数を追加
<xp:pager rendered="#{javascript:isPagerVisible(this) |
katoman |
Aug 19, 2015 |